What Happens When Exterior Doors are Installed Incorrectly?

Proper exterior door installation completed by Brookstone Windows & Doors

Exterior doors that are installed incorrectly can begin to leak in and around the doors, specifically underneath the sill. When the moisture from outside gets in underneath the sill, water begins to soak into the rim of the house as well as the floor joists supporting foyer under the door. In some cases, we have had to replace part of the rim and cripple the floor joists to properly support the door again after the rot had set in. 

Tips for Proper Exterior Door Installation

In order to prevent lasting issues with your new door, here are some steps you should follow when beginning an exterior door installation project:

1. Caulk the Door’s Perimeter

Make sure that the base of the sill plate is properly caulked using a perimeter caulking technique to ensure proper bonding of the sill and sill plate below.

2. Square the Door Frame

Make sure the exterior door is square and plumb in the opening during the installation.

3. Prepare the Door Sill

If a sill extension is required during the exterior door installation, make sure to measure it out and remove it if it’s too long prior to installation rather than trying to install it after the door is in due to potential damage to the sill during the installation of the sill extension.

4. Seal and Insulate your Exterior Door 

As one of the final steps, it’s important to properly seal and insulate around the door frame. This will seal your exterior door from leaks or drafts. During this step, be aware of how much expanding insulation is being used in the door frame, as too much can warp or bend your door frame.
